§ 12-14-29-5 — Court referral for SNAP and TANF benefits; 12 month TANF benefit limitation

Indiana·Art. 14 FAMILY ASSISTANCE SERVICES·Ch. 29 Assistance for Reentry Court Program Participants
(a)If referred by a court, an individual who meets the requirements of section 2 of this chapter may receive federal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program (SNAP) benefits.
(b)If referred by a court, an individual who meets the requirements of section 3 of this chapter may receive TANF benefits for not more than twelve (12) months.

Legislative History

As added by P.L.92-2005, SEC.3. Amended by P.L.5-2015, SEC.36; P.L.209-2018, SEC.7.
